Here is my TRICK! 

Nowadays we all have nifty smart phones and we also have students leaving our classroom at random times. I could not keep all of my students times straight, so I decided to set an alarm for each student or groups of students to help us all remember that they need to go! My kiddos love it because I let them choose a sound from my phone and I love it because it keeps us all on track! 



So, give it a try and let me know how it goes!

My newest product is up and running! My kiddos struggle with skip counting so I whipped up this center pack that makes skip counting a little more hands-on. This pack focuses on counting by: 2's, 3's, 5's, and 10's. Each group of skip-counting cards also follows a pattern with the clip art images this will help the kiddos figure out the correct order AND it gives us educator folk the ability to simply glance over from our small group or needy student and see if they are on the right track!
